The global transparent conductive oxide market is currently worth US$ 686.8 Mn. It is expected to mark an annual growth rate of around 10.5% during 2025-2035.
The increase in demand for flexible electronics such as flexible screens and touch panels, requires high performance transparent conductive oxide material. In addition, the requirement for transparent, conductive coatings in energy-efficient products and increase the adoption of solar cells further boost the market.
Innovation in materials such as cost-effective and environmentally-friendly transparent conductive oxide alternatives, also forms market dynamics, with continuous research to increase conductivity and transparency.
Transparent conducting oxide systems target a wide variety of industries including electronics, automobiles, renewable energy, and construction. Among some of the major demographics of these industries are electronic device manufacturers looking for advanced TCO Materials with performance for screens, touch sensors, and photovoltaic cells.
Renewable energy companies mainly focusing on solar and thin-film solar cells are also in this mix. The architectural firms involved are also the ones designing energy-saving buildings with smart windows and glass. Automobile industries aim to incorporate technologies in smart glass into vehicles.
